In the study of Isaiah 36, we noted that the king of Assyria offered the people prosperity if they surrendered (vv. 16-17). A thought from the post “A Jump of Faith“ is that the enemy’s promises are deceptive.
Fortunately, God’s promises are reliable and are certain. We can build our faith on the rock of His Word. Our faith doesn’t come out of nowhere but comes from work and dedication. Let us today do as the song Dive by Steven Curtis Chapman suggest. Let us dive into the deep waters and obey God’s orders.
